FAQs - Real Estate Lawyers in city Richmond How many Real Estate lawyers actively serve residents of Richmond, Virginia? Approximately 84 licensed attorneys focus on Real Estate across Richmond, Virginia. Most matters are filed through the Virginia District Court, where local rules shape timelines and filing steps. What is the typical hourly fee for Real Estate lawyers in Richmond, Virginia? In Richmond, typical rates range from $267-$435 per hour for Real Estate. End-to-end case budgets frequently land between $2517 and $7393, depending on hearings and discovery. How long do Real Estate matters usually take in courts near Richmond? Real Estate cases in Richmond, Virginia usually take around 3-9 months depending on complexity and the Virginia District Court docket. Which local court most often hears Real Estate cases for people living in Richmond, Virginia? Residents of Richmond typically see Real Estate filings handled by the Virginia District Court. Proximity to helps with quick submissions and clerk communications. Do attorneys around offer a free first consultation for Real Estate? About 50% of firms near ZIP offer a free first consultation for Real Estate, so you can compare strategy and fit before committing.

Victor was born and raised in Richmond and grew up working and learning business and service in his father’s restaurant, starting when he was 10 years old.  He earned his B.A. from the University of Richmond and Juris Doctorate from the T.C. Williams School of Law in 1980.  For his first 10 years of practice, Victor was a litigation attorney and a member of the Virginia Trial Lawyers association, concentrating his practice in civil and criminal defense litigation and residential real estate transactions at the firm of White, Blackburn, and Conte.. In 1995, Victor founded Shaheen Law Firm and currently serves as its Chief Executive Officer and Director of its real estate transaction operations.  Victor is a member of the Virginia State Bar, Henrico County Bar Association, is admitted to practice in the Federal District Court for the Eastern District of Virginia, is a member of the Employee Relocation Council, the Greater Richmond Relocation Council, is a certified Relocation Professional and serves as Vice President and Director on the Board of Bon Air Title.. With 9 lawyers and 40 paralegals, Shaheen Law Firm has a state-wide presence and has facilitated over 100,000 residential real estate and relocation transactions over the last 20 years in every city and county in Virginia.  Shaheen Law Firm is one of the largest providers of settlement services in the mid-Atlantic region of the United States.

Jennifer D. Mullen is a member at Roth Jackson focusing in commercial real estate and land use law. Ms. Mullen represents developers and landowners in the acquisition, disposition, development and financing of residential subdivisions and planned unit developments, office and residential condominiums, office buildings, multi-family housing projects and shopping centers. She routinely represents clients in obtaining zoning, permitting and development approvals, as well as negotiating economic development agreements. Ms. Mullen has also represented a variety of owners in the acquisition, development and construction of multi-family housing intended to qualify for federal low-income housing tax credits.. Ms. Mullen has been named a “Legal Elite” by Virginia Business magazine and a “Rising Star” by Virginia Superlawyers magazine and is in The Best Lawyers in America- Women in the Law.

Andrew M. Condlin is a member at Roth Jackson, focusing in commercial real estate and land use law. Mr. Condlin represents developers and landowners in every aspect of commercial real estate, particularly in matters relating to land use, zoning, economic development, transactional matters (purchase, sale, lease, financing), historic preservation and local government law issues. He also assists local governments, volunteer boards and private developers in amending and drafting local zoning ordinances and comprehensive plans. The extent of Mr. Condlin’s diverse land use practice places him in regular contact with local governing bodies, commissions and administrators as well as relevant developers and civic associations allowing him to establish and maintain relationships with these individuals and organizations.. Mr. Condlin is the recipient of the Henrico Business Council’s Award of Merit for 2005 and named the 2004 Virginia Bar Leader of the Year by the Virginia State Bar’s Conference of Local Bar Associations. In 1998, Mr. Condlin was named one of Richmond’s “Top 40 Under Forty” by Inside Business magazine. Mr. Condlin has been included in Virginia Business magazine’s list of the “Legal Elite” and was recognized by Chambers USA as a leading real estate attorney in Virginia, each since 2004. Mr. Condlin has been named a “Super Lawyer” for Land Use/Zoning by Virginia Super Lawyers magazine and is listed in The Best Lawyers in America, each since 2004. Mr. Condlin was selected in 2004 as a member of the VCU Real Estate Circle of Excellence.. Mr. Condlin has taught various real property courses at Virginia Commonwealth University and William & Mary School of Law. Mr. Condlin is rated AV Preeminent® by Martindale-Hubbell® Peer Review Ratings™.
